Evgeny Kuznetsov Misses Practice Due To Illness, Will Be A Game-Time Decision
Center Evgeny Kuznetsov was absent from the Washington Capitals‘ practice on Saturday due to illness. He will be a game-time decision for Sunday afternoon’s game against the San Jose Sharks (12:30 PM ET, NBC Sports Washington). The 27-year old is … Continue reading
